Angels: Celestial Guardians
Often depicted as beings of light and purity, angels occupy a prominent position in religious and spiritual traditions. Contrary to popular belief, angels are not believed to be reincarnated humans; rather, they are considered celestial servants of a higher power, divinely tasked with specific roles in relation to humanity. These roles vary widely, encompassing a spectrum of responsibilities from delivering divine messages to acting as spiritual warriors.
Gabriel, a prominent figure in the Bible, is revered as a messenger of God, while Michael is known as a powerful warrior who defends against evil. Other angels are believed to act as guardians, offering protection and guidance to individuals on Earth. These guardian angels are perhaps the most widely believed in and frequently witnessed form of angelic presence in the modern era.
Angels are described in myriad forms, ranging from radiant, winged figures bathed in celestial light to more subtle, nondescript beings dressed in ordinary attire. Regardless of their appearance, angels are generally considered benevolent entities whose purpose is to serve a higher power and assist humanity.
Demons: Agents of Darkness
In stark contrast to angels, demons represent the forces of evil and darkness. Like angels, demons are not believed to have ever lived as humans. Instead, they are considered to be malevolent entities that serve the will of Satan or other dark forces. Their primary purpose is to tempt, torment, and corrupt humans, often manifesting in terrifying and grotesque forms.
Demons are notorious for their ability to possess humans (and even inanimate objects), causing their victims to behave in ways that are entirely alien to their character. These possessions can manifest in a variety of ways, including violent outbursts, uncontrollable fits, and the display of superhuman strength.
The removal of a demon from a possessed individual typically requires the services of an exorcist, a religious figure or spiritual practitioner with the authority and knowledge to cast out evil spirits. Alternatively, someone who is considered exceptionally pious and pure of heart may also be capable of performing an exorcism. The battle against demonic forces is a recurring theme in religious and supernatural lore, highlighting the eternal struggle between good and evil.
Ectoplasm (Vapors and Mists): Spectral Emanations
Ectoplasm, often referred to as vapors or mists, is a substance frequently associated with paranormal activity, particularly the manifestation of apparitions. It is typically described as a grey, white, or bluish fog that appears either independently or immediately before the appearance of a ghostly figure.
This spectral mist can move in various directions, seemingly defying the laws of physics by passing through solid objects. Its appearance is often likened to exhaled breath on a cold day or cigarette smoke, leading to frequent misidentification in ghostly photography.
While the existence of ectoplasm remains a subject of debate among paranormal investigators, it continues to be a significant element in ghost stories and supernatural lore.
Apparitions: Visible Manifestations of the Deceased
Apparitions are perhaps the most widely recognized and iconic form of ghostly phenomenon. They are defined as the visible appearance of a deceased person or animal, manifesting in either a clear and distinct form or a more blurry and indistinct manner.
Apparitions often appear suddenly and disappear just as quickly, frequently observed at a distance, such as in an upper window of a house. These spectral figures have been reported to move through solid objects, such as walls and doors, seemingly unhindered by physical barriers. A sudden drop in temperature often accompanies their presence, adding to the eerie and unsettling atmosphere.

Free Spirits: Wandering Souls
Free spirits are entities believed to be the disembodied souls of individuals who have once lived. Unlike ghosts, which are often trapped in a specific location or cycle of behavior, free spirits possess the ability to travel and interact with the living at will.
These spirits can choose to "drop in" and engage with the world around them, coming and going as they please. They remain in this state until they either reincarnate into a new life or ascend to a higher astral plane of existence. The concept of free spirits offers a more optimistic perspective on the afterlife, suggesting that souls retain a degree of autonomy and freedom even after death.
Ghosts: Echoes of Trauma
Ghosts, in contrast to free spirits, are often portrayed as trapped souls, tethered to a specific location or event due to unresolved trauma or emotional attachment. They are believed to be surviving emotional memories of individuals who died tragically or traumatically, often unaware of their own demise.
These spectral figures may appear confused or frightened, reliving the same events indefinitely until something or someone breaks the cycle. They remain in familiar places, repeating the same actions, unable to let go of their physical attachments.
The concept of ghosts as trapped souls is a recurring theme in ghost stories and folklore, highlighting the lingering impact of trauma and the importance of resolving emotional wounds.
Orbs: Spheres of Energy
Orbs are small, sphere-shaped masses of energy believed to be either the nascent stage of an apparition or a complete manifestation in themselves. They move independently at varying speeds and are typically invisible to the naked eye, making them a common anomaly captured on film.
While orbs are frequently cited as evidence of paranormal activity, it is important to note that many can be explained by mundane factors such as dust particles, insects, or camera flaws. However, photographs of orbs with light trails behind them are considered more reliable indicators of paranormal activity. Place or Residual Memories: Imprints of the Past
Some hauntings manifest as eerie replications of past events, with ghostly figures engaged in activities that were common during their lives, such as walking, talking, or working. These phenomena are often referred to as place or residual memories, and are explained in several ways by paranormal investigators.
One explanation suggests that the ghosts are simply repeating actions that they frequently performed in life. Another theory draws upon the science fiction concept of the time-space continuum, proposing that two time frames can sometimes overlap, resulting in a glimpse into the past.
The third explanation, and perhaps the most intriguing, is the concept of a "place memory," which posits that past events can leave an imprint on the environment, similar to a recording. These residual hauntings replay images and sounds in a continuous loop, suggesting that there may be no actual ghost present, but rather a psychic "record" of a person from long ago.
Poltergeists: Mischievous Spirits
Poltergeists, derived from the German words for "noisy ghost," are a unique form of ghostly phenomenon characterized by their disruptive and mischievous behavior. They are believed to gain energy from living individuals, most often children or teenagers, and convert it into the ability to move solid objects.
Poltergeists often announce their presence with rapping noises or other unsettling sounds, generally creating disorder and chaos. They are known for engaging in acts of mischief, such as throwing furniture around, slamming doors, and creating other disturbances.
While poltergeist activity can be frightening and disruptive, it is not typically considered to be malicious. The source for the energy, usually children or teenagers, are often the focus of the activity.
Spook Lights: Mysterious Illuminations
Spook lights, also known as ghost lights, will-o-wisps, or ignis fatuus (foolish fire), are unexplained lights seen glowing in the distance at night. These lights can appear in a variety of colors, including white, blue, and yellow.
Many documented examples of spook lights exist around the world, including the lights near Joplin, Missouri, the Marfa Lights in South Texas, and the Dover Lights in northwest Arkansas. While the exact cause of spook lights remains a mystery, they continue to be a source of fascination and speculation for both scientists and paranormal enthusiasts.
Vortexes: Portals to the Unknown
Vortexes are swirling, funnel-shaped mists that often appear in photographs, particularly indoors. These anomalies exhibit a thread-like quality in their structure and are believed by some to be spirits themselves.
However, a growing consensus suggests that vortexes may represent a method of transport between two worlds, serving as portals or gateways for spirits to move between dimensions. They are frequently observed in conjunction with orbs, but can also appear independently.
The concept of vortexes adds another layer of complexity to the understanding of paranormal phenomena, suggesting that the boundaries between our world and the spirit world may be more permeable than previously imagined.
